What is CASI Pharmaceuticals Revenue?

CASI Pharmaceuticals FRA:ENM 29 Revenue is €18.18 Mil as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ates FRA:ENM with a GF Score™ of 29/100 and a GF Value™ of €10.30. The stock has 5 warning signs investors should review.

CASI Pharmaceuticals's rev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2025 was €6.17 Mil. Its rev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was €18.18 Mil. CASI Pharmaceuticals's Revenue per Share for the three months ended in Dec. 2025 was €0.23. Its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was €1.00.

Warning Sign:

CASI Pharmaceuticals Inc revenue per share has been in decline for the last 5 years.

During the past 12 months,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ate of CASI Pharmaceuticals was -39.90%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was -29.30%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was -4.90% per year. CASI Pharmaceuticals  (FRA:ENM) Revenue Explanation

In ranking the predictability,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

Peter Lynch categorized companies according to their revenue growth:


Slow Grower: Inflation <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 10%:
Stalwart: 10% <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 20%:
Fast Grower: 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ate > 20%:

His favorite companies are stalwart, those growing between 10-20% a year.

Companies in cyclical industries may see their revenue fluctuate wildly in good years and bad years.


Be Aware

Revenue can be manipulated by changing the way how revenue is booked. Companies may book sales before the payment is received, or before the revenue is fully earned. These will be added to balance sheet items such as account payable or account receivables.

CASI Pharmaceuticals Business Description

Other Exchanges CASIF:USA
Address Jianguo Road, No. 81, Room 1701-1702, China Central Office Tower 1, Huamao Office Building, Chaoyang District, Beijing, CHN, 100025
CASI Pharmaceuticals Inc is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company developing CID-103, an anti-CD38 monoclonal antibody, for patients with organ transplant rejection and autoimmune diseases. Additionally, the company manages its other assets, including EVOMELA, FOLOTYN, CNCT19, BI-1206, and CB-5339, with a primary strategic emphasis on advancing CID-103 toward key clinical and regulatory milestones. It also distributes YuTuo (Zimberelimab), a fully human anti-PD-1 monoclonal antibody for patients with relapsed or refractory classical Hodgkin's lymphoma and recurrent or metastatic cervical cancer. Geographically, the company's revenue is solely generated in Mainland China.
